Have you seen the VH1 classic albums series on the making of the album? The story behind Smoke on the Water is totally true. The band had to resort to a run down hotel with a mobile unit and recording in hallways. After each take they'd have to climb out a 2nd story window and walk across the roof to get to the truck to listen to the take.

It's amazing the album came out as great as it did. I wonder how different it would have come out if the Casino hadn't burned down.
